Luton boss Rob Edwards had no complaints after their 6-2 FA Cup hammering by Manchester City at Kenilworth Road.
Erling Haaland hit five goals on the night for the visitors.
Edwards said of the Fifth Round defeat: "Manchester City were pretty good, weren't they? We came up against a brilliant team and brilliant individuals who are well coached.
"We are going to evolve and hopefully get better. We are not going to change even though tonight we left ourselves exposed at times. At 3-2 we are in the game. The fourth one was obviously a bit of a killer.
"We could have been a bit better. We are quite bold. Sometimes when you come up against that kind of opposition you get a bit of a doing."
